Are people in Brewster older or younger than people in Fort Edward?
- The Median Age in Brewster is 12.9 years younger than in Fort Edward.

Are housing costs cheaper in Brewster or Fort Edward?
- Brewster housing costs are 84.7% more expensive than Fort Edward hous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Brewster or Fort Edward?
- The average commute for residents of Brewster is 15.8 minutes longer than it is for residents of Fort Edward.

Things to do in Fort Edward?
Fort Edward, NY is a small town located on the eastern bank of the Hudson River. It is surrounded by beautiful rolling hills and fields that stretch for miles, providing plenty of outdoor activities for residents to enjoy. With a population of just over 3,000 people, Fort Edward is a great place to get away from the hustle and bustle of city life. The town has numerous parks and trails for walking, biking, and other outdoor activities. The downtown area offers quaint cafes and restaurants with local specialties like fresh fish fries and clam chowder. Residents here also enjoy summer festivals and celebrations like the annual Kite Festival at Rogers Island Park. All in all, living in Fort Edward is an enjoyable experience that provides plenty of opportunities to relax, explore nature, and mingle with friendly locals.

Things to do in Brewster?
Brewster, NY is a small town located in Putnam County. It has a population of around 11,000 people and it provides many conveniences that make living there comfortable. The town centers around its historic downtown area with shops, restaurants, and other small businesses providing residents with plenty to do throughout the year. With its close proximity to the Metro North train station, Brewster is also convenient for commuters who need easy access to New York City and Westchester County. Residents can also enjoy nature at nearby lakes and parks or in their own backyards with plenty of green space and open land surrounding the community. All in all, living in Brewster can be an enjoyable experience for those looking to get away from the hustle and bustle of city life without sacrificing creature comforts or convenience.
